Arytenoidectomy is a permanent and irreversible surgical procedure whereby the laryngeal inlet is widened in its transverse axis, providing a larger airway for respiration. Arytenoidectomy partially removes the Arytenoid cartilage.

Arytenoidectomy is the permanent and irreversible procedure by which the laryngeal inlet is widened in its transverse axis so that larger airway is formed for respiration. This procedure is performed in cases of bilateral vocal immobility.
Some of the symptoms of Arytenoidectomy are hoarseness, noisy breathing, loss of vocal pitch, choking or coughing while swallowing food, drink, inability of speak loudly, loss of gag reflex.
Bilateral vocal immobility are caused due to bilateral neurogenic palsy, fixation of cricoarythenoid joint, laryngeal synechia.
Arytenoidectomy is a safe, complete and terminal treatment of BVFI for ensuring proper breathing.
In the process of Arytenoidectomy the vocal folds are cut or narrowed and the arytenoids is cut to make sure that the width of airway in throat is widened and the space is sufficient for breathing.
A partial arytenoidectomy takes about 1 hour to perform and a total arytenoidectomy takes 50 minutes to perform.
Arytenoidectomy is done by Pulmologist or by general surgeon.
Arytenoidectomy is done under general anesthesia with endotracheal intubation, mostly using carbon dioxide laser. If the preexisting tracheostomy is not present then intubation is done with a 5.0 or 5.5 laser-safe endotracheal tube and the larynscope is suspended and angled toward the operative site.
